Transaction 29de26feb29c77c88dc7cea0fbf23e1871a7f8eb3268943a11d1759cde78af71

2 Input
2 Outputs
  • 29de26feb29c77c88dc7cea0fbf23e1871a7f8eb3268943a11d1759cde78af71:0
  • value  2663132
    address  3KAWNoTCvqUKQiBN4ZKiKsU1wnK6CfninC
  • 29de26feb29c77c88dc7cea0fbf23e1871a7f8eb3268943a11d1759cde78af71:1
  • value  172345564
    address  31wpX9nJcigcMcfYuJ28YEw4YtvMHsp9JM